Variables used in Shear Stress in I Section PDF

  1. Aabv Area of Section above Considered Level (Square Millimeter)
  2. b Thickness of Beam Web (Millimeter)
  3. B Width of Beam Section (Millimeter)
  4. d Inner Depth of I Section (Millimeter)
  5. D Outer Depth of I section (Millimeter)
  6. Fs Shear Force on Beam (Kilonewton)
  7. I Moment of Inertia of Area of Section (Meter⁴)
  8. y Distance from Neutral Axis (Millimeter)
  9. ȳ Distance of CG of Area from NA (Millimeter)
  10. 𝜏beam Shear Stress in Beam (Megapascal)
  11. 𝜏max Maximum Shear Stress on Beam (Megapascal)
